The ongoing liberalization of markets, rapid technological changes, digitalization and the establishment of new business models in aviation raise new questions related to theory and practice. Current and future developments in aviation are thereby shaped by the industry actors and structures, in short, the Aviation System.

To lead your company or department efficiently from a systemic management point of view, a deeper understanding of the industry and all actors on a global scale is essential for aviation managers. The diploma encompasses 5 courses offered by the University of St.Gallen, and 3 electives offered by IATA, which will enable you to explore and analyze topics in-depth, ranging from aviation systems and revenue management to sustainability and change management.

You will become a trusted leader by gaining greater knowledge on the global aviation industry as a whole and the crucial regulations and their impact on business strategies and operations. Frameworks for quality and safety management, as well as for auditing processes will help you and your companies to comply with these regulations.

The Diploma of Advanced Studies is offered in cooperation between University of St. Gallen and International Air Transport Association. The program content is delivered by academic and industry leading lecturers from HSG and IATA.

Program structure

The program consists of 8 courses. Five courses are compulsory, delivered by the University of St.Gallen (HSG) with a selection of core elective courses offered by IATA. For the IATA electives, participants are required to complete a minimum of 12 and a maximum of 14 course days.

2026 Schedule

Complete the 5 Required courses:
  • Module 1: Accountable Aviation Management (HSG): 12-17 January 2026, in-person (St. Gallen, Switzerland)
  • Module 2: Strategy and Business Models (HSG): 11-12 March 2026, in-person (St.Gallen/Laax, Switzerland)
  • Module 3: Responsible Leadership, Integrated Management and Organization (HSG): 9-12 June 2026, in-person (St. Gallen, Switzerland)
  • Module 4: Sustainable Risk and Safety Management (HSG): 9-12 September 2025 or 8-11 September 2026, in-person (St. Gallen, Switzerland)
  • Module 5: Auditing in Aviation (HSG): 24-26 November or 23-25 November 2026, in-person (St. Gallen, Switzerland)
Choose 3 Elective courses from the list below:
  • Elective 1: Airline Leading Practices and Cost Reduction Strategies (IATA)
  • Elective 2: Revenue Management and Pricing with simulation (IATA)
  • Elective 3: Airline Business Models and Competitive Strategy (IATA)
  • Elective 4: Network, Fleet and Schedule Planning (IATA)
  • Elective 5: Design a Sustainability Strategy (Advanced) (IATA)

Registration

The total cost for the IATA - University of St Gallen Diploma of Advanced Studies (DAS) in Global Air Transport Management Program (8 courses) is from CHF22,900. The price is dependent on the number of course days of IATA Electives (CHF22,900 for 12 IATA course days; CHF23,450 for 13 IATA course days; CHF24,100 for 14 IATA course days)

If you have completed any IATA classes that are part of the DAS curriculum or other classes from the airline management portfolio, you may be eligible for a transfer credit of up to USD1,500 per class. Employees of airlines and civil aviation authorities in developing nations may be eligible for a DNA discount. Conditions apply. Please contact the Academic Program Manager for details.

A passing mark of 70% is required on all assignments and exams. A special distinction is awarded to candidates who obtain a distinction in all, or all but one, of all course exams and assignments that are incorporated in this program.
